Investment decision:

Investment decision can be referred to as capital budgeting. It involves finding solutions to questions like whether to add to capital assets today will increase the revenues of tomorrow to cover costs.

Explanation of Solution

Option a.

Hurdle rate of return can be referred to as a minimum rate that the corporation expects while investing in a particular project. It is also known as target rate.

Hence, option (a) is correct.

Option b.

Payback period is a type of capital budgeting technique which describes the number of year or length of time needed for proposal‘s cumulative cash inflow to be equal to its cash outflow.

Hence, option (b) is not correct.

Option c.

Internal rate of return can be defined as a metric applied used to measure the profitability of potential investment. It is a discount rate which makes net present value of all cash flow equals to zero.

Hence, option (c) is not correct.

Option d.

The average rate of return is a type of capital budgeting technique which is based on accounting principle of return on investment. It is the annualized net income earned on the average funds invested.

Hence, option (d) is not correct.

Option e.

Maximum rate of return is the maximum proportion of return a corporation expects from the project. This rate is generally always beyond the estimated targets.

Hence, option (e) is not correct.

Conclusion

Hence, it can be concluded that the minimum acceptable rate of return for an investment decision is the hurdle rate of return. Therefore, option (a) is correct.
